Leeds team win inaugural Triathlon Mixed Relay Cup

    A team from Leeds won the inaugural Triathlon Mixed Relay Cup in Nottingham.

    The new format, which will make its Olympic debut in 2020, comprises two men and two women, who each complete a super-sprint triathlon - a 300m swim, 7.5km bike ride and 1.5km run - before 'tagging' their team-mate to take over.

    The Leeds 1 team, made up of Tom Bishop, Georgia Taylor-Brown, Jess Learmonth and Aaron Royle, beat 16 other domestic and international quartets with a total time of one hour 18 minutes 58 seconds.
